Duquesne Light Company headquartered in downtown Pittsburgh is a leader in providing electric energy and has been in the forefront of the electric energy market with a history rooted in technological innovation and superior customer service. Today the company continues its role as a leader in the transmission and distribution of electric energy providing a secure supply of reliable power to more than half a million customers in southwestern Pennsylvania.

Job Title:Infrastructure Engineer II

Position Summary: Duquesne Light is seeking a motivatedInfrastructure Engineer IIto support enterpriseLinux storage and virtualization platforms.

This role focuses onday-to-day operations troubleshooting incident response and routine system maintenance (including patching)to ensure secure stable and reliable infrastructure supporting both corporate andmission-critical utility systems.

This position offers the opportunity todevelop deeper technicalexpertiseand grow into more advanced infrastructure engineering responsibilities over time.

Location:Pittsburgh PA

Job Duties and Responsibilities:

Infrastructure Support & Incident Response

  • Provide operational support for Linux storage and virtualization environments
  • Respond to alerts and incidents restoring service within defined SLAs
  • Troubleshoot issues across compute storage and virtualization layers
  • Perform incident triage escalation andassistwith root cause analysis

Linux Systems Administration

  • SupportRHEL and Oracle Linux (OEL)environments
  • Perform routine administration including:
  • System patching and updates
  • Provisioning and configuration
  • Performance monitoring
  • UtilizeRed Hat SatelliteandOracle Linux Automation Manager (OLAM)

Storage & Data Protection

  • Support storage platforms:
  • Pure Storage
  • Dell EMC Isilon
  • Assistwith backup and recovery tools:
  • Avamar Rubrik Acronis
  • Perform backup validation and support restore operations

Virtualization

  • SupportVMware vSphereandOracle Linux KVM
  • Assist with VM provisioning configuration and performance monitoring

Automation & Tools

  • Utilize andmaintainautomation using:
  • Ansible
  • Basic scripting (Bash/Python)
  • Support existing automation and configuration management processes

Application Platform Support

  • Support infrastructure for enterprise systems such as:
  • Oracle Utility Suite
  • IBMMaximo
  • Outage Management System (OMS)
  • Transmission & DistributionSCADA
  • Troubleshoot infrastructure-related issuesimpactingapplication performance

Monitoring & Maintenance

  • Monitor system health and respond to alerts
  • Perform routine maintenance activities includingpatching and updates
  • Follow established change management and operational procedures

Security & Identity

  • Support Linux patching hardening and compliance activities
  • Assist withRed Hat Identity Management (IdM)and access controls

On-Call Support

  • Participate in on-call rotation
  • Support after-hours incidents and scheduled maintenance as needed
